A factory reset will delete all downloaded content and restore your Yoto Player or Yoto Mini to factory conditions.
To factory reset a Yoto Player:
- Within three seconds of this red pulse, release all three buttons and press the orange button on the right-hand side once.
- Press and hold all three buttons on the Yoto Player until the nightlight pulses red.
- The nightlight will briefly flash orange and then shut down once reset is complete.
To factory reset a Yoto Mini:
- Press and hold all three buttons on the Yoto Mini until a red dot appears on the screen.
- Within three seconds of this red button, release all three buttons and press the orange button on the right-hand side once.
- An orange dot should appear and then shut down once reset is complete.

Remove the device from the previous account:
A factory reset will not remove the device from your family account. If you are giving it to someone else, make sure to also delete its name and remove it from your family account, through the Yoto App.
To remove it from the family account:
Go to the Settings tab in the Yoto App
Tap on the device to open the settings page
At the top of the page, delete the Player Name
Scroll to the bottom of the settings page
Select “Remove from family account”.
Leave the old family account
If you received a Yoto player from someone else, but they have forgotten to first remove it from their account, you can leave their family account by:
Go to the Settings tab in the Yoto App
Tap on the three dots next to your user
Select “Leave this family account”.
